What are Split Leg Shorts?

Split leg shorts, also known as "split skirts" or "badminton skirts," are a type of athletic wear specifically designed for sports like badminton, tennis, and table tennis. These shorts are characterized by their unique design, which features two separate panels that divide the garment down the middle.

The split leg design allows for a wide range of movement and flexibility, making these shorts ideal for sports that require quick and agile movements. The panels can split apart when the wearer moves, providing ample legroom and reducing the risk of restriction. Additionally, the breathable and lightweight fabrics used in split leg shorts help to keep athletes cool and comfortable during intense physical activity.

Split leg shorts are typically made from moisture-wicking fabrics that draw sweat away from the skin, ensuring dryness and comfort. They also feature a drawstring waistband or elastic waistband that provides a secure fit. Some models may also include side or back pockets for convenience.
